Reset Files and Directories permissions

From time to times, we must fix permissions on files and directory in order to secure an installation or to fix a broken one.

The process is quite straight forward and simple.

If you are hosted with us:
1) Log to your server using SSH
2) Execute the following software (it is installed with our servers):
fixpermissions

If you are hosted on your own dedicated server
1) Log to your server using SSH
2) Point yourself in your Apache folder (at the root of your website)
3) Run those commands

find . -type f -exec chmod 644 {} \;
find . -type d -exec chmod 755 {} \;
chmod 550 pear
chmod 550 mage

And the last bit: QA!
4) Visit your Magento's install and see if everything still run smoothly


And that's about it!
